Design of a Nb 3 Sn 400 T/m Quadrupole for the Future Circular Collider

For the Future Circular Collider (FCC), a 100-TeV post Large Hadron Collider machine, 750 main quadrupoles with a gradient of around 400 T/m are required. This paper presents an electromagnetic design optimization of a double aperture Nb3Sn quadrupole, fulfilling the specifications and a structural design of a single aperture configuration towards a prototype.
